AI doesn’t have to be complicated—or intimidating. This webinar will help builders who are curious about AI, but unsure about where to start. In this one-hour session, you will hear directly from builders and see real examples of how they are using AI to save time, reduce headaches, and improve profitability across marketing, operations, and finance—no tech background required. Join fellow builders Robert Carroll, Carroll Construction, Mary Peters, Sasquatch Contracting, Stacy Beers, Pacific InterWest with moderator Don Bronchick, BuilderBeast Consulting to get inspired. You’ll leave with clear ideas and next steps you can use to start saving time with AI right away.

Robert Carroll is the owner of Carroll Construction, LLC, a design-build construction company focused on rural luxury homes outside the Greater Baton Rouge, Louisiana market. A licensed residential and commercial contractor with more than 15 years of experience in construction management, custom homebuilding, and remodeling, Robert has led his company’s transition to a design-build model centered on transparency, financial accountability, and exceptional client experience.
Robert brings a strong national leadership and committee background through the National Association of Home Builders. He serves as incoming Chair of the NAHB Housing Finance Committee, is the Immediate Past Chair of the Single Family Finance Subcommittee, and is the 1st Vice Chair of the Business Management and Information Technology Committee. His industry involvement also includes code and resilience work, including contributions to the Louisiana State Uniform Construction Code Council Fortified Roofing Task Force and service on the NAHB Construction Codes and Standards Committee. Locally, he has served as President of the Greater Baton Rouge Home Builders Association and remains active in government affairs.
On this panel, Robert will share practical, field-tested ways contractors can apply AI in everyday operations—improving documentation, standardizing processes, strengthening customer communication, and reducing administrative drag—without losing the trust and professionalism that define a strong builder-client relationship.
